Background: The COVID-19 outbreak is currently the major public health concern worldwide. This infection, caused by the novel coronavirus Sars Cov2, primarily affects respiratory system, but there is increasing evidence of neurologic involvement and cerebrovascular accidents. Case Report: We present a case of stroke in a 62-year-old COVID-19-positive patient, with multiple vascular risk factors. The patient arrived 1 h after onset of symptoms, was treated with recombinant tissue plasminogen activator (rtPA) with improvement of neurologic deficits, and later developed right foot arterial ischemia (recanalized by balloon catheter angioplasty) and left arm superficial venous thrombosis. A control computed tomography (CT) scan 7 days after onset showed hemorrhagic transformation of ischemic lesion without mass effect. However, respiratory and neurologic conditions improved so that the patient was discharged to rehabilitation. Discussion: Until now, few cases of stroke in COVID-19 have been described, mainly in severe forms. This patient had ischemic injuries in different sites as well as venous thrombosis; hence, we speculate that Sars Cov2 could have a direct role in promoting vascular accidents since its receptor ACE2 is a surface protein also expressed by endothelial cells. This case suggests that COVID-19 can favor strokes and in general vascular complications, even in milder cases, and the presence of preexisting risk factors could play a determinant role.

Thrombotic diseases like ischemic stroke are common complications of essential thrombocythemia (ET) due to abnormal megakaryopoiesis and platelet dysfunction. Ischemic stroke in ET can occur as a result of both cerebral arterial and venous thrombosis. Management of ET is aimed at preventing vascular complications including thrombosis. Acute management of ischemic stroke in ET is the same as that in the general population without myeloproliferative disorder. However, an ET patient with ischemic stroke is at high risk for re-thrombosis and therefore additionally managed with cytoreductive therapy and antithrombotic agents. Given abnormal platelet production in ET, there is suboptimal suppression of platelets with the usual recommended dose of Aspirin for cardiovascular (CV) prevention. Hence, for optimal CV protection in ET, low dose Aspirin is recommended twice daily in an arterial thrombotic disease like atherothrombotic ischemic stroke in presence of the following risk factors: age > 60 years, Janus kinase2V617F gene mutation, presence of CV risk factors. In presence of the same risk factors, concurrent antiplatelet and anticoagulant therapy is suggested for venous thrombosis. However, increased risk of bleeding with dual anti-thrombotic agents poses a significant challenge in their use in cerebral venous thromboembolism or, atrial fibrillation in presence of the above-mentioned risk factors. We discuss these dilemmas about antithrombotic management in ischemic stroke in ET in this cased based review of literature in the light of current evidence.

Abstract This study retrospectively evaluated 144 consecutive patients with unusual site thrombosis who referred to our Thrombosis Center between 2000 and 2016. All patients were classified as having either splanchnic venous thrombosis (SVT; n=127) or cerebral venous thrombosis (CVT; n=17). On the presence and type of provoking risk factors, then patients were categorized into three groups: unprovoked, those with possibly resolved provoking factors (PR), and those with persistent provoking factors (PP). Among the identified risk factors regarded as PP, we focused on Myeloproliferative Neoplasms (MPN) and performed a clinical comparison between MPN patients with SVT (MPN-SVT) and those with CVT (MPN-SVT). The characteristics of our cohort well reflects the clinical heterogeneity of clinical features commonly found in the routine clinical practice of diagnosing unusual site thrombosis. One hundred and twenty seven SVT patients were included: 7 unprovoked SVT, 10 SVT with PR, 110 SVT with PP; seventeen patients showed CVT, 5 unprovoked, 6 CVT with PR and 6 CVT with PP. Major risk factor for SVT with PP was liver cirrhosis (71.6%), whereas for CVT were MPN (5 patients, 29.4%). MPN was present in 8 patients (6.2%) of SVT (MPN-SVT vs MPN-CVT, p=0.009). For MPN-SVT, 3 patients showed the morphological features of polycytemia vera (PV), 2 of essential thrombocytemia (ET), 1 of primary myelofibrosis (PMF) and 2 fell into the MPN unclassified category (U-MPN); distribution of MPN subtypes for CVT was as follows: 1 PV, 2 ET and 2 U-MPN. Molecular analysis identified the JAK2V617F mutation respectively in 75% patients with MPN-SVT and in 60% patients with MPN-CVT; bone marrow histological features supported the diagnosis of MPN in all cases. Median age at MPN-SVT diagnosis was 46 years (range 17-78) vs 43 years (range 31-84) for MPN-CVT. Coexisting PR and thrombophilic abnormalities were identified in 75% and 20% of MPN-SVT and MPN-CVT respectively, so MPN are per se a strong risk for thrombosis and the leading systemic cause of CVT. In four of five cases (80%), CVT antedate the clinical phenotype of an overt MPN, whereas SVT occurred at MPN diagnosis in five patients and during MPN follow-up in three patients (median 164 months, range 88-215). At diagnosis MPN-SVT tended to have significantly lower platelet and white blood cell counts and haemoglobin concentration than MPN-CVT (respectively p<0.001, p<0.001 and p=0.002). Similar proportion of MPN patients in the two groups received cytoreductive treatment (hydroxyurea and alpha interferon) and appropriate anticoagulant therapy that consisted of low molecular weight heparin (LMWH) followed by oral vitamin K antagonists (VKA). MPN-SVT and MPN-CVT experienced similar median duration of anticoagulation (26 months for MPN-SVT, range 1-62, and 26 months for MPN-CVT, range 4-168) and a good quality anticoagulation control (median time within therapeutic range of 71 vs 87% respectively for MPN-SVT and MPN-CVT). Seventy-five percent MPN-SVT and 80% of MPN-CVT remain on indefinite anticoagulation. All patients were alive at last follow-up and the results of imaging techniques showed resolution of thrombosis in 87.5% and 80% of MPN-SVT and MPN-CVT respectively; the probability of recanalization of the occluded vessels was 18 months and 4 months for MPN-SVT and MPN-CVT, respectively. Only in one patient with MPN-SVT, a major bleed occurred on-treatment while the incidence of recurrent thrombosis was the same for both MPN-SVT and MPN-CVT (0.02 per 100 patients-year). In conclusion, our study evaluated unselected populations with unusual site thrombosis that were followed in our Thrombosis Center, an anticoagulation clinic well experienced on pathogenic mechanisms and anticoagulant treatment. Our findings have practical implications and point out the role of MPN as a major contributory factor for the pathogenesis of CVT with PP, even in absence of overt myeloproliferative features and additional prothombotic factors. Regarding management of vascular complications, patients with MPN-SVT and MPN-CVT responded equally well and efficacy of anticoagulation was not affected by the site of thrombosis. Background: Venous thrombosis, the leading cause of free flap failure, may have devastating consequences. Many anti-thrombotic agents and protocols have been described for prophylaxis and treatment of venous thrombosis in free flaps. Methods: National surveys were distributed to microsurgeons (of both Plastics and ENT training) and hematology and thrombosis specialists. Data were collected on routine screening practices, perceived risk factors for flap failure, and pre-, intra-, and post-operative anti-thrombotic strategies. Results: There were 722 surveys distributed with 132 (18%) respondents, consisting of 102 surgeons and 30 hematologists. Sixty-five surgeons and 9 hematologists routinely performed or managed patients with free flaps. The top 3 perceived risk factors for flap failure according to surgeons were medical co-morbidities, past arterial thrombosis, and thrombophilia. Hematologists, however, reported diabetes, smoking, and medical co-morbidities as the most important risk factors. Fifty-four percent of physicians routinely used unfractionated heparin (UFH) or low-molecular-weight heparin (LMWH) as a preoperative agent. Surgeons routinely flushed the flap with heparin (37%), used UFH IV (6%), or both (8%) intra-operatively. Surgeons used a range of post-operative agents such as UFH, LMWH, aspirin, and dextran while hematologists preferred LMWH. There was variation of management strategies if flap thrombosis occurred. Different strategies consisted of changing recipient vessels, UFH IV, flushing the flap, adding post-operative agents, or a combination of strategies. Conclusions: There are diverse practice variations in anti-thrombotic strategies for free tissue transfers and a difference in perceived risk factors for flap failure that may affect patient management.

Abstract Background The new coronavirus disease 2019 pandemic has spread throughout most of the world. Cerebral venous thrombosis is a rare thromboembolic disease that can present as an extrapulmonary complication in coronavirus disease 2019 infection. Case presentation We report the case of a Hispanic woman with Down syndrome who has coronavirus disease 2019 and presents as a complication extensive cerebral venous thrombosis. Conclusions Cerebral venous thrombosis is a rare thromboembolic disease that can present as an extrapulmonary complication in coronavirus disease 2019 infection. In the absence of clinical and epidemiological data, it is important to carry out further investigation of the risk factors and pathophysiological causes related to the development of cerebrovascular thrombotic events in patients with Down syndrome with coronavirus disease 2019 infection.

AbstractA cross-sectional study was carried out to determine the seroprevalence of Toxoplasma gondii and associated risk factors in pigs in the largest pork-producing region in Cuba. Serum samples from 420 pigs, including 210 sows and 210 post-weaning pigs, were tested for antibodies against T. gondii using a commercial indirect enzyme-linked immunosorbent assay. Anti-T. gondii antibodies were detected in 56 animals (13.3%, 95% CI: 10.1–16.6). A generalized estimating equations model revealed that the risk factors associated with higher seropositivity in pigs were altitude (higher in farm’s location < 250 m above sea level (masl) versus ≥ 250 masl) and age (higher in sows compared to post-weaning pigs). The results indicated that this protozoan parasite is widely distributed on pig farms in the study area, which is a public health concern since the consumption of raw or undercooked pork meat products containing tissue cysts is considered one of the main routes of T. gondii transmission worldwide. Control measures should be implemented to reduce the risk of exposure to T. gondii in pigs in Cuba.

Research suggests that as many as 60% of people with type 1 diabetes (T1D) admit to misusing insulin. Insulin omission (IO) for the purpose of weight loss, often referred to as diabulimia, is a behaviour becoming increasingly recognised, not least since prolonged engagement can lead to serious vascular complications and mortality. Several risk factors appear to be relevant to the development of IO, most notably gender, anxiety and depression and increased weight concerns and body dissatisfaction. Evidence suggests that women, especially young girls, are more likely to omit insulin as a method of weight loss compared to men. Mental health conditions such as anxiety and depression are increasingly prevalent in people with T1D compared to their peers, and appear to contribute to the risk of IO. Increased weight concerns and body dissatisfaction are further prominent risk factors, especially given increases in weight which often occur following diagnosis and the monitoring of weight by diabetes teams. This review presents evidence examining these risk factors which increase the likelihood of a person with T1D engaging in IO and highlights the complications associated with prolongment of the behaviour. Further research looking at the comorbidities of these risk factors, alongside other factors, would provide greater insight into understanding IO in people with T1D.

Abstract Background Limited information exists on the incidence of postoperative deep venous thromboembolism (DVT) in patients with isolated patella fractures. The objective of this study was to investigate the postoperative incidence and locations of deep venous thrombosis (DVT) of the lower extremity in patients who underwent isolated patella fractures and identify the associated risk factors. Methods Medical data of 716 hospitalized patients was collected. The patients had acute isolated patella fractures and were admitted at the 3rd Hospital of Hebei Medical University between January 1, 2016, and February 31, 2019. All patients met the inclusion criteria. Medical data was collected using the inpatient record system, which included the patient demographics, patient’s bad hobbies, comorbidities, past medical history, fracture and surgery-related factors, hematological biomarkers, total hospital stay, and preoperative stay. Doppler examination was conducted for the diagnosis of DVT. Univariate analyses and multivariate logistic regression analyses were used to identify the independent risk factors. Results Among the 716 patients, DVT was confirmed in 29 cases, indicating an incidence of 4.1%. DVT involved bilateral limbs (injured and uninjured) in one patient (3.4%). DVT involved superficial femoral common vein in 1 case (3.4%), popliteal vein in 6 cases (20.7%), posterior tibial vein in 11 cases (37.9%), and peroneal vein in 11 cases (37.9%). The median of the interval between surgery and diagnosis of DVT was 4.0 days (range, 1.0-8.0 days). Six variables were identified to be independent risk factors for DVT which included age category (> 65 years old), OR, 4.44 (1.34-14.71); arrhythmia, OR, 4.41 (1.20-16.15); intra-operative blood loss, OR, 1.01 (1.00-1.02); preoperative stay (delay of each day), OR, 1.43 (1.15-1.78); surgical duration, OR, 1.04 (1.03-1.06); LDL-C (> 3.37 mmol/L), OR, 2.98 (1.14-7.76). Conclusion Incidence of postoperative DVT in patients with isolated patella fractures is substantial. More attentions should be paid on postoperative DVT prophylaxis in patients with isolated patella fractures. Identification of associated risk factors can help clinicians recognize the risk population, assess the risk of DVT, and develop personalized prophylaxis strategies.
